Carbon1.3.0 Concurrent Load-Drop: user is able to drop table even if insert/load job is running
Steps:
1: Create a table
2: Start a insert job
3: Concurrently drop the table
4: Observe that drop is success
5: Observe that insert job is running and after some times job fails
Expected behvaiour: drop job should wait for insert job to complete
